History: The idea of an international Women’s Day first arose at the turn of the century, when in 1909, the first National Women’s Day was observed in the United States. By 1910, 100 women from 17 countries, who had gathered in Copenhagen, unanimously approved a proposal to establish an annual Women’s Day to honor the women’s rights movement and to support universal suffrage for women. Since its early conception, International Women’s Day has assumed a global dimension for women in developed and developing countries.

International Women’s Day has been celebrated by the United Nations (UN) since 1975. The UN’s annual commemoration serves to focus attention on the rights of women around the world, and highlights women’s issues globally and focuses on their achievements. In 2004, the World Trade Center Miami
decided to sponsor this event annually to recognize women who have inspired others to make major achievements in international business. More than 400 international executives/media attend the event each year.

Speaker: Romaine Seguin, President UPS Americas Region

Romaine SeguinRomaine Seguin, president of UPS Americas Region, is responsible for all UPS package and cargo operations in Canada and more than 50 countries and territories across Latin America and the Caribbean. Additionally, she has oversight of the UPS Supply Chain Solutions operations throughout Latin America, Miami and the Caribbean.

Romaine began her career with UPS in the Missouri district in 1983 as a part-time hub supervisor. She held a variety of operational and management roles in Missouri and was later promoted to hub manager. In 1989, Romaine accepted a five-year assignment in Europe as part of the integration team with F&A and operations, and lived in both the UK and France.

In 1994, Romaine returned to the U.S. as controller for the air district, based in Louisville, Kentucky. From 1996 to 1999, she returned to operations as the ramp and hub division manager in Louisville. In 1999, Romaine relocated to Detroit, Michigan as the operations division manager. In 2001, Romaine was promoted to managing director of the Gulf South district and in 2004, was named managing director of the Minnesota district.

In October 2007, Romaine moved to Milan, Italy as the managing director of UPS South Europe and was shortly promoted (March 2008) to Chief Operating Officer for the Europe, Middle East and Africa region, based in Brussels, Belgium. In September 2010, Romaine was promoted to her current position as president of the UPS Americas Region based in Miami, Florida.

Romaine is an active board member of the Florida International University (FIU) School of Business Dean’s Council and sits on the Transportation Advisory Board for Best Buy Inc. She is also the current President of Conferencia Latinoamericana de Compañías Express (CLADEC) – Latin America Conference of Express Companies. Romaine holds a degree in Marketing Management from William Woods College in Fulton, Missouri and an MBA from Webster University in St. Louis, Missouri.
